I respect that many of my customers brew their coffee in a manner that I dislike immensely (auto drip.) I am aware of the speed and ease of that brewing method. It does not do Incredible Coffee justice but it does give you a fresh, hot mug of coffee in a pinch. Sometimes, time is of the essence. However, I am baffled by the use of the Keurig System that so many are using. In these times of rising land fills, I ask “why?” This process only makes one serving at a time and leaves the rest of us to deal with the many little plastic cups that will sit around on the earth for years to come. Is it that difficult to use a permanent filter in your already existing sub-standard auto drip maker? Please take a moment to rethink this choice.
I have also been asked, many times, why I do not carry “fair trade” coffee beans. I would love to share why. The price of coffee has risen over the years. Fair trade beans are even more expensive. The idea behind fair trade is that there exists a middle party who actually insures that the farm workers are paid a “fair” wage and treated “well.” I have yet to see proof that this “middle man” exists. Why would I deny the farms I do purchase from business and jeopardize the jobs of the workers? I love the premise behind fair trade. When there is a government sanction that oversees the well being of the workers in these remote countries, I will reconsider.
